Investigation into the denial of access to a child’s personal information by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ada
The complainant requested his minor child's passport application from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ada (IRCC), citing a court order granting him access to his children's information. IRCC denied the request, stating the child's consent was required. The OPC found that while the complainant had legal authorization to act on his child's behalf, the request was not made for the child's benefit or best interests, a key condition under the Privacy Regulations. Therefore, the OPC concluded that the complainant did not have a right of access to the child's personal information.
